我的第一次真實工程經(jīng)歷
5.26日這一天我的心情是格外的興奮,激動。
因為我終于有機會去體驗真實的工程操作,這是我盼望已久的。
早上我起的比平常早一個多小時,準備了許久才滿懷希望的走出家門坐上公交車,不知道怎么搞得平時堵的不能動彈的馬路,那天格外的順暢。到了陽明國際,我看了看表時間不到七點(哈哈,來得真早)干脆就坐在門口等老大,一邊等我就一邊想會不會讓我親自上手操作呢,越想越興奮時間不知不覺已經(jīng)過去半個小時了。
剛好老大也來了,七點半(也挺早)因為那邊要求我們八點五十就要到達目的地,所以我倆不敢耽擱時間。
檢查好應該帶的東西,consle線,筆記本,交叉線等等,我,老大,楊工就急急忙忙的出發(fā)了,坐上車我們心里總想著讓車走快點恨不得車能飛起來,結果我們都傻眼了--堵車。
沒辦法我們只能祈禱路快點通,借著這個機會,老大讓我們看了上海聯(lián)通公司給我們發(fā)過來的工程需求,哇塞全是英文,
還好有老大他簡單給我們介紹了這次工程概況---為西安ibis酒店裝配一臺cisco的2811路由器,以及三個模塊()并且在上邊配置MPLS ×××(這可是我第一次聽說,長了見識了,呵呵)。
聽著聽著已經(jīng)到了大差市,下了車我們就開始找地方,還好我對西安比較熟悉(嘿嘿),大概走了不到500米我突然看見一個大大牌子西安宜必思酒店。
我們到了,時間八點半剛剛好,想著馬上就能見到各式各樣的網(wǎng)絡設備及拓撲心理就一陣竊喜。
這時老大給酒店網(wǎng)絡管理員打電話,結果我們就更傻眼了,原來人家也堵車,哎呀?jīng)]辦法等吧。
九點十分,網(wǎng)管終于到了,再他的指引下我們來到ibis的機房。
進去以后,好冷(給設備降溫用的空調),機房不大但是很整齊,各式設備擺放的井井有條,經(jīng)過和網(wǎng)管的交談得知人家用的設備是一樣兩臺.......好有錢呀。
其中設備主要有cisco的2950交換機,電話交換機,以及中國電信贈送的華為交換機,協(xié)議轉換器,其中最引人注目的就是一臺和印度連接的juneper防火墻--這是我以前見都沒見過的東西,真是大飽了眼福。
接下來,我們從網(wǎng)管那里得知現(xiàn)在酒店通過網(wǎng)通的光纖和上海的總部進行直接的通信,這就是要用到2811路由器,還有聯(lián)通的協(xié)議轉換器(V.35接口)
工程正式開始,首先酒店方的網(wǎng)管打開了2811路由器的包裝箱,終于現(xiàn)出廬山真面目了。
拿到設備后老大讓我們檢查了設備數(shù)目和收貨單上是不是匹配(這是很重要的),其中包括三個模塊,兩根直通線,一根(一端是串行口一端是V.35)。
正當我們要裝模塊的時候,發(fā)現(xiàn)模塊已經(jīng)裝配好了(真是爽,可是又覺得遺憾少了親自裝配模塊的經(jīng)歷)。
打開筆記本電腦連上consle線,連上路由器的串行口,另一端接到了聯(lián)通光纖的協(xié)議轉換器上,一切準備妥當。
打開電源后,機器運行正常,登陸到超級終端后,show running 后發(fā)現(xiàn)路由器的基本配置已經(jīng)被上海的工程師刷到上邊了,并且運行了MPLS ××× ,show ip int brief后發(fā)現(xiàn)物理鏈路狀態(tài)已經(jīng)是UP了,可是我們發(fā)現(xiàn)二層協(xié)議是down的,因為是二層協(xié)議所以不存在路由協(xié)議,ip地址之類的問題。
那是什么原因呢,我們手動激活端口后,狀態(tài)up了之后又跳轉到down,經(jīng)過思考會不會是封裝格式不對,封裝成ppp后還是沒反應。
我們陷入了沉思,突然楊工說能不能把寄存器的值修改成0x2142,結果還是不行。
接下來,老大給上海的工程師打電話,對方說是兩端的速率不一致,要打電話和西安聯(lián)通線路工程師核實一下(因為酒店用的是512k,擔心ce端把線接到了2m的口上),很快人家回復沒問題。
我們排除了路由器的問題,物理連接的問題,后來老大說是要做打環(huán)測試,可是我們沒有現(xiàn)成的工具做不成的,這下可難住我們了,后經(jīng)過聯(lián)系聯(lián)通的線路工程師,說可能是線路出了問題。
不一會人家就過來了,經(jīng)過打環(huán)確認線路沒有問題,那會是什么問題呢,我都快崩潰了。
老大再次打電話給上海工程師,對方回復說是讓西安聯(lián)通數(shù)據(jù)部門ping一下pe到ce,我們想了二層協(xié)議沒up怎么會ping通。
又一次失敗了,已經(jīng)12點了,人家都去吃飯了可我們沒心思吃(其實我已經(jīng)餓得不行了)。
這時,聯(lián)通工程師建議我們先去吃飯,他再找找協(xié)轉的問題。
匆匆吃完飯,回到ibis酒店繼續(xù)討論,我都有點退縮的想法,就在這時聯(lián)通工程師帶來了好消息,說是協(xié)轉的速率跳線開關可能設置不對,拆下協(xié)轉我們驚奇的發(fā)現(xiàn)協(xié)轉背后還有幾組微小的跳線開關,我的天,經(jīng)過正確的設置后(調成512k),安轉好協(xié)轉后,二層協(xié)議立刻就up,show ip bgp ,show ip route后發(fā)現(xiàn)出現(xiàn)bgp路由信息,ping 對方的ip地址是通的。
我們高興得都蹦了起來,接下來進行了調試,一切正常,這時已經(jīng)是下午四點了。我們終于長舒了一口氣
這次工程經(jīng)歷,我不僅學到在學校學不到的知識,而且見到很多以前沒見過的設備。在
實際的工程中,我們會遇到一些非常棘手的問題,只要我們頭腦清醒的去回憶我們曾經(jīng)學到的知識,我相信沒有處理不了的問題。
這次工程經(jīng)歷使我認識到我自身知識的不足,再接下來的學習中,我要踏踏實實的掌握每一個知識點,原理。
只有這樣,才會在今后真正的工作中得心應手。
不能泄露商業(yè)信息,所以我就把不重要的配置給大家看看
ian02#show ip route
Codes: C - connected, S - static, R - RIP, M - mobile, B - BGP
D - EIGRP, EX - EIGRP external, O - OSPF, IA - OSPF inter area
N1 - OSPF NSSA external type 1, N2 - OSPF NSSA external type 2
E1 - OSPF external type 1, E2 - OSPF external type 2
i - IS-IS, su - IS-IS summary, L1 - IS-IS level-1, L2 - IS-IS level-2
ia - IS-IS inter area, * - candidate default, U - per-user static route
o - ODR, P - periodic downloaded static route
Gateway of last resort is 210.53.161.109 to network 0.0.0.0

xian02#show run
Building configuration...
Current configuration : 3761 bytes
!
version 12.4
service timestamps debug datetime msec
service timestamps log datetime msec
no service password-encryption
!
hostname xian02
!
boot-start-marker
boot system flash:c2800nm-advipservicesk9-mz.124-15.T1.bin

interface Loopback0
no ip address
!
interface FastEthernet0/0
description IBIS xian02
ip address X.X.X.X 255.255.255.192
ip access-group To_SHAccor_In in
duplex auto
speed auto
!
interface FastEthernet0/1
no ip address
shutdown
duplex auto
speed auto
!
interface Serial0/0/0
description MPLS ×××
bandwidth 512
ip address X.X.X.X 255.255.255.252
no fair-queue
!
interface BRI0/1/0
no ip address
encapsulation hdlc
shutdown
!
interface BRI0/2/0
no ip address
encapsulation hdlc
shutdown
!
router bgp 65086
no synchronization
bgp log-neighbor-changes
redistribute connected
redistribute static
neighbor X.X.X.X remote-as 9929
no auto-summary
!
!
!
no ip http server
ip http access-class 23
ip http authentication local
no ip http secure-server
ip http timeout-policy idle 60 life 86400 requests 10000
!
ip access-list extended To_SHAccor_In
permit ip any 57.0.0.0 0.255.255.255
permit ip any 172.19.0.0 0.0.255.255
permit ip any 172.20.66.0 0.0.0.255
permit ip any 172.20.65.0 0.0.0.255
permit ip any host 172.20.89.33
!
